Remember that your dominating focus attracts, through a definite law of nature, by the shortest and most convenient route, their physical counterpart. Be careful of what you focus on.
Napoleon Hill
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Your primary focus shapes your reality; therefore, be mindful of what you concentrate on.

This quote by Napoleon Hill emphasizes the importance of focus in shaping our reality. It suggests that the thoughts and intentions we concentrate on attract corresponding outcomes in our lives, underscoring the need to be selective and intentional about what we allow to dominate our minds.
